## Cron Drift Investigation — Provenance Notes

So the Quillbarn nightly builds started landing twelve minutes late last week. Turns out the cron host drifted after the Marrowgate NTP relay got decommissioned. We re-pointed it and rebuilt from a clean snapshot. If you need to confirm which artifact came from the fixed host, check the token below.

trace token, bafof-bafof: htk3_228

Internal Memo — Gross-Margin Review

To the board: the half-year review of Quillstone Manufacturing shows gross margin slipping from 41% to 37%, driven chiefly by input cost inflation on the Ardent line and unrecovered freight surcharges. Mitigations under evaluation include supplier consolidation, a modest list-price adjustment, and phasing out two low-volume variants. A fuller analysis will follow at the next session. The confidential note below outlines the strategic plans this review informs.

internal memo for kawip-hadug: Headcount on the Wenwyn team goes from 7 to 140 by the end of January. Gross margin on Wenwyn came in at 20 percent against a plan of 15 percent.

## Changelog — Font vendoring defaults changed

As of this release, the Bracken UI build no longer fetches third-party fonts at build time. All typefaces used by the Lanternwell suite are now vendored into the repo under a dedicated assets directory, and the fetch step is skipped by default. If you're onboarding, nothing to install — the fonts travel with the checkout. The build flags controlling this behavior are listed below.

settings of hadup-yafog:
LAMAEL_PIN=3761
LAMAEL_TENANT=istmir
LAMAEL_METRICS_HOST=metrics.lamael.plorvasys.test
LAMAEL_SEAL=seal_8ea68500
LAMAEL_STANDBY_TEAM=fraok

Document Transport — Print Shop Master Copies

Quick guide for moving master copies to Bramblehurst Print Co. These are the only originals, so treat the run like a valuables transfer, not a regular parcel drop. Use the red tamper-evident envelopes from the supply shelf, log the seal number in the transport book, and never combine the run with general mail. The masters go directly to the press supervisor, nobody else. On arrival, the courier must follow the hand-over instruction stated below.

drop instructions, kajep-tageg: the kasvan casdor courier leaves the quenvan quenox druox ledger at gate 4316 under passcode 799004